Output 00e6cbec84330fec20a9124b774c07fa013924eb4ba5bfabf822f09eb03d76a9:44

value
1382595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0effc32d7862f9f1d2174dfbfa0b47aaf8a133f7 OP_EQUAL
address
334KmuvkT4TLhANHB49QKP7vYT77z4ZgKk
transaction
00e6cbec84330fec20a9124b774c07fa013924eb4ba5bfabf822f09eb03d76a9
spent
true